Though most people know Tom Stoppard from his Oscar-winning screenplay for "Shakespeare in Love," he's more prolific writing for the stage. And to date, four of his works have won Tony Awards for Best Play.

Kansas City, MO – His plays aren't often seen on Kansas City stages, but the UMKC Theatre department is rectifying that with "Arcadia," and hopes to warm people up to a playwright whose works are considered the most challenging of contemporary theater.
